Police open fire at murder suspects after attack near RR Nagar

In a dramatic turn of events near Shanmukha Temple in RR Nagar, Bengaluru, police opened fire at two murder suspects who allegedly attacked officers with lethal weapons during an attempted arrest. The accused, Deepu (28) and Arun (27), were reportedly involved in the murder of a man named Vijay and were shot in the legs in an act of self-defense.

According to police, the two suspects had killed Vijay (26) on Saturday night by luring him to Janata Colony in JJ Nagar under the pretext of a conversation. Vijay had been released from jail earlier the same day. The murder is believed to have stemmed from an old rivalry.

Acting on credible intelligence that the suspects were hiding in the RR Nagar police limits, a police team including JJ Nagar PI Kempegowda and PSI Padmanabha attempted to arrest them. During the operation, the suspects allegedly attacked ASI Kumar and Constable Kareemsab with deadly weapons. In response, Inspector Kempegowda fired a warning shot into the air, but when the suspects continued their assault, officers fired at their legs to subdue and apprehend them.

The injured officers and suspects were immediately taken to the hospital for treatment.

Speaking on the incident, Bengaluru West Division DCP S. Girish confirmed that the accused were hiding in RR Nagar after murdering Vijay in JJ Nagar’s Janata Colony. "Even after warning shots, the suspects attempted to attack the police. They were shot and arrested in self-defense," he stated.

He also confirmed that Vijay had a criminal background and had been released from prison just hours before he was killed. Authorities are continuing their investigation while ensuring medical care for both the injured officers and suspects.
